Legends of K'Darl #3 - Arrival in Kreshington



Our heroic *ahem* group of adventurers travelled day and night, resting only as they needed to. They passed through abandoned hamlets, homesteads devoid of life, all showing signs of a struggle, wreckage littering the ground.

Stopping at one of the larger farms, the group disembarked from the newly named wagon (Rolling Thunder) and cautiously explore the area. They find broken objects and dried blood, yet nothing of value seems to have been stolen. A large pyre sits some distance from the buildings, still smoking. Ganon and K'rang, both being trained in magic, sense the lingering presence of some dark magic in the area, though what it was used for they cannot say. Having gleaned what information the could from the site, they once again climb aboard Rolling Thunder and continue their journey.

After another days travel, the group arrive in Kreshington just as the sky is starting to darken. The group speaks with one of the city guard captains, learning that they had been burning the bodies they found at the various homesteads, explaining the pyre they had seen. He pointed them in the direction of an in where survivors were taking refuge. The group then split, some heading to the inn, others heading to the markets and some heading to the academy to utilise the library. 

Between them, they learn that the hamlets are being attacked by dark shadows, summoned into being by some ancient and dark magic, almost beyond all knowledge. The only information they managed to obtain from the refugees was that none of the older families had been killed, and that they had been taken by these things, whatever they were. When pressed further, the survivors told them that the older families are descendants of the builders who helped to originally found Kreshington, having worked on either its construction, or the construction of one of the great statues of King Britemane the First that were present in all 5 of the major cities and in the capital too. As they are questioning one of the survivors further, a fresh face appears in the inn, stumbling across the room, muttering of shadows and evil. The group quickly learn that he has travelled from a nearby homestead, which was attacked the previous night. 

The group gather their things and head out, hoping to find some fresh clues at the site of this latest attack.
